在Wireshark中如何精确抓取并分析SNMP数据包?请结合实际操作步骤给出详细解答。
时间: 2024-12-09 14:28:07 浏览: 12
精确地在Wireshark中抓取并分析SNMP数据包是网络管理中的一个重要技能,而《网络管理实验指导:Wireshark与SNMP实践》这本书籍为你提供了丰富的实验指导和理论支持。为了精确抓取SNMP数据包,首先需要理解SNMP的协议结构,包括其使用的端口号(通常为UDP 161和162)、版本(如SNMPv1、SNMPv2c和SNMPv3)以及基本的PDU结构。
参考资源链接:[网络管理实验指导:Wireshark与SNMP实践](https://wenku.csdn.net/doc/68rh94cjkh?spm=1055.2569.3001.10343)
在Wireshark中进行抓包,你可以使用过滤器来定位SNMP相关的流量。例如,过滤器表达式为'snmp',可以捕获所有与SNMP相关的数据包。一旦开始捕获,你可以查看每个数据包的详细信息,包括协议头部、SNMP版本、团体字符串、请求类型等。
接下来,通过展开SNMP协议树,你可以看到包含变量绑定列表的PDU部分。变量绑定列表包含了对象标识符(OID)和相应的值,这些通常是我们监控网络设备时最关心的数据。你可以详细分析每个OID的含义,了解其代表的网络参数,例如接口统计信息、设备温度、内存使用率等。
实际操作步骤如下:
1. 启动Wireshark并选择相应的网络接口进行捕获。
2. 输入过滤器'snmp',点击“开始”按钮开始捕获SNMP数据包。
3. 在捕获到的数据包列表中,找到SNMP数据包并双击打开详细信息。
4. 在SNMP协议树下,展开查看所有的字段,特别注意PDU类型、请求ID、错误状态、错误索引以及变量绑定列表。
5. 分析每个变量绑定的OID和值,对照SNMP MIB库理解这些值代表的网络管理信息。
通过以上步骤,你可以对网络中的设备进行有效的监控和管理。建议在掌握了基础的数据包分析技能后,进一步深入学习《网络管理实验指导:Wireshark与SNMP实践》中提供的高级实验和案例,这将帮助你更全面地理解网络管理知识,提高解决实际问题的能力。
参考资源链接:[网络管理实验指导:Wireshark与SNMP实践](https://wenku.csdn.net/doc/68rh94cjkh?spm=1055.2569.3001.10343)
阅读全文